Common Real Estate Legal Issues Faced by Residents

Residents of Bay Shore often encounter a range of real estate legal issues. One common concern is property disputes, which can arise from boundary disagreements, easements, or issues with neighbors. Additionally, many homeowners face challenges related to zoning laws that dictate how properties can be used. For example, a homeowner may wish to convert a single-family residence into a rental property only to find that local zoning regulations prohibit such a change.

Another frequent issue involves the complexities of buying and selling properties. From reviewing purchase agreements to navigating title searches, the intricacies of real estate transactions demand legal expertise to prevent costly mistakes. Moreover, residents may also face foreclosure issues, particularly in a fluctuating market, highlighting the need for legal guidance throughout the process.

Typical Lawyer Fees and How They Vary in This ZIP

In Bay Shore, the fees for hiring a real estate lawyer can vary significantly based on the complexity of the legal issues and the lawyer's experience. Typically, clients can expect to pay anywhere from $150 to $400 per hour. For simpler transactions, such as drafting and reviewing real estate contracts, many lawyers offer flat fees ranging from $500 to $1,500. However, for more complicated matters, such as litigation involving property disputes, fees may escalate considerably.

Additionally, it's important to factor in other potential costs, such as title search fees, court filing fees, and administrative expenses, which can further impact the overall cost of legal services in the area.
